Thomas buys a certain brand of cereal that costs $8 per box. Luke changes to a super-saving brand of the same size. The equation

shows the price, y, as a function of the number of boxes, x, for the new brand.
y = 6.9x

Part A: How many more dollars is the price of a box of Thomas' original brand of cereal than the price of a box of the super-saving brand? Show your work.

Part B: How much money does he save each month with the change in cereal brand if he buys 6 cereal boxes each month? Show your work. (10 points)

Answer:

A. $1.10      B. $6.60

Step-by-step explanation:

A. The equation y = 6.9x shows that the price of the new cereal is $6.90 because if x is 1 then the price is 6.9. From this we can find the difference of prices between the two cereal boxes: 8 - 6.9 = $1.10

B. The total amount of money for the original cereal is $8 × 6 = $48

The amount of money for the new cereal is $6.90 × 6 = $41.40

The money saved is: $48 - $14.40 = $6.60
